_KyKa_ Posted June 19, 2010 Share Posted June 19, 2010 from interviewmagazine.com In our June-July issue, we pay tribute to 20 years of of ridiculously good-looking manly-men that Dolce & Gabbana has dressed. A much-anticipated party on June 19 during Milan men's fashion week will celebrate the brand's anniversary. To honor the evolution of the label and the man, we photographed 20 of the biggest male models in the designers' current collection. With the addition of their signatures, each one transformed a behind-the-scenes Fuji Film Instax Mini Polaroid into a custom birthday card. There's only one question: Who wore it best ?
